Queen-Laing condo developer files OMB appeal
Community group ‘shocked’ by move, vows to keep pushing for development that fits in with neighbourhood 



"..

Members of the recently revived East Toronto Community Coalition (ETCC), the same group that successfully stopped SmartCentres from building a big box development on Eastern Avenue, views Rockport’s decision to appeal to the OMB as a slap in the face.

“It was as shock, I have to say,” said Victoria Dinnick, who serves as the group’s co-chair.

“We didn’t see it coming.”

Dinnick, like many in the community, has spent countless hours meeting with the developer in an effort to come up with a design that works better for the neighbourhood. She’s attended several meetings and took part in a working group.

“The actual working group was rather frustrating. People felt it was just presenting information. It wasn’t until the end that we felt meaningful ideas were discussed,” Dinnick said.
